  • Abstract
    The National Science Foundation, through its Program for Engineering Sciences, has been active in supporting research in engineering sciences since 1951. However, there remains a considerable lack of understanding of the Foundation´s role and the assistance it can give to those in need of support for fundamental research. This article was prepared in an effort to bring to electrical engineers a better idea of the Foundation and its work.
